Falcon Manor Wedding Photography


Falcon Manor could not have been a better winter wedding venue for Jess and Rowan’s intimate, romantic candle lit and snowy wedding on Saturday. I was excited to be taking their wedding photographs in such a cozy and warm venue as I ploughed through the snow on the short drive from the other side of Settle in the stunning Yorkshire Dales. I’d taken no chances with storm Eunice looming over us the night before and decided it was best to travel up that evening to ensure I didn’t miss any of the wedding festivities.


Winter Wedding at Falcon Manor


I arrived at Falcon Manor as the snow was falling heavily and took the opportunity for a quick wander around the snow filled grounds with my camera. Some of the lovely guests smiled and waved down at me with my camera from their warm and inviting looking rooms as I scampered, very happily, around the grounds with my wide angel lens in the snow!


Jess was getting ready in the Rafter's Suite at Falcon Manor when arrived so I had a chat with Rowan and we had a quick look around at some of the gorgeous wedding details they had put together including the candles in the ceremony room and the Elizabeth wedding cake.


I then joined Jess in the main suite as she happily got ready with her gorgeous little girl, sister and mum. The amazing Rafters Suite has huge windows which provided the most perfect natural light for stunning bridal preparation photos. I also spent some time with Rowan and best man Jack who were doing a great job relaxing before the ceremony in the bar!


Wedding Ceremony at Falcon Manor


Jess and Rowan's wedding ceremony took place in the light filled main room which has huge windows that open onto the terrace. The couple had filled the room with candles which resulted in a beautiful, warm wedding ceremony that was full of emotion which I loved capturing for them on my camera. Their daughter sat just behind the couple with Jess's family which created lovely, natural wedding photographs.


After a short, relaxed and intimate wedding service, there was time for a quick drink before we headed outside for confetti photographs and a few traditional group shots as the snow had stopped and the blue sky was starting to appear.


Romantic Wedding Photography at Falcon Manor


We took advantage of the weather (something I always do) improving and were able to take some beautiful couple photographs in the snow within the Falcon Manor grounds. The snow on the ground and the blue skies looked spectacular through my lens and I was thrilled to be able to give Jess and Rowan and their families a sneak peak at them on my camera screen after our ten minute stroll around the gardens.


Small intimate wedding reception at Falcon Manor


After our couple photos, we headed back inside the lovely warm building to be greeted with a roaring fire and champagne and canapes being served, which the wedding party were enjoying!


Jess and Rowan wanted a simple and relaxed day with their guests and so when the time came to be seated for the wedding breakfast they skipped any speeches and sat down to enjoy food and drinks with their lovely family and friends.


Evening wedding reception at Falcon Manor


The team at Falcon Manor did an amazing job to ensure that the evening party went ahead despite the weather conditions. The DJ got the party started after the cutting of the cake. Friends and family watched Jess and Rowan's first dance and then needed little encouragement to join them on the dance floor. Much fun was had late into the evening!
